Case Management Systems Developer – Legal Software / Process – Leeds – REF 766

  • Job Location - 423 Kirkstall Road, Leeds, LS4 2EW

Job Purpose

To develop our legal case management system and other applications as required using the design tools provided by our suppliers. To play a key role in system upgrades from our suppliers, ensuring seamless integration with our existing systems and that all supporting documentation is produced / updated.

DIMENSIONS

  • Working within a team, alongside other Case Management System Developers and Analyst Programmers and reporting into the Lead Case Management System Developer.
  • The role requires the holder to work as part of potentially several working party teams at any one time.
  • Working with internal stakeholders from around the business in identifying and translating requirements through to proposing (including effort estimates), designing, developing, testing and implementing solutions.
  • To design and develop new processes and documentation within our case management system to support the development of the business.
  • To assist with all aspects of duties which fall under the remit of the IT Development Team, including Support, as and when required.
  • To liaise with the reporting team and assist with identifying areas for SQL reports.
  • To assist with database and system management generally.

SCOPE OF THE ROLE

  • An element of the work is project based and also some changes need to be made ‘out of hours’ therefore a need to be flexible as to working hours and to be prepared to work additional hours is necessary.

Person specification

  • Must be a good communicator who is happy to engage and challenge peers or managers alike.
  • Must have a logical, analytical mind and the ability to recognise discrepancies.
  • Must be proactive in suggesting and advising on ways to improve service to internal and external clients.
  • Must be able to manage own workload, prioritise, remain effective under pressure and deliver to deadlines.
  • Must plan and document thoroughly all proposed actions and foresee any risks associated with those actions.
  • Must ensure quality and accuracy at all times.

SKILLS / QUALIFICATION / Experience Requirements / Education Requirements

Required

  • Development experience of any case management system (preferably legal).
  • Experience of interrogating SQL databases by compiling and executing SQL queries.
  • Experience of creating and utilising testing plans.
  • Experience of working in a busy office environment.
  • Experience of planning tasks to achieve an end goal.

Desirable but not essential

  • Experience of creating/running macros.
  • Knowledge of VBA/VB.
  • Experience of pre-legal collections/legal collections/secured legal processes.
  • Development experience of Liberate by Linetime
